This required adding the inode number to the IVs. For ext4, this precludes filesystem shrinking, so I've also added a compat feature which will prevent the filesystem from being shrunk. I've separated this from the full "Inline Encryption Support" patchset (https://lkml.kernel.org/linux-fsdevel/20190821075714.65140-1-satyat@google.com/) to avoid conflating an implementation (inline encryption) with a new on-disk format (INLINE_CRYPT_OPTIMIZED). This patchset purely adds support for INLINE_CRYPT_OPTIMIZED policies to fscrypt, but implements them using the existing filesystem layer crypto. We're planning to make the *implementation* (filesystem layer or inline crypto) be controlled by a mount option '-o inlinecrypt'.
